Liverpool are unbeaten in their last seven league home games against United with four wins and three draws in that time.
Notably, winning the last two games by an aggregate score of 11-0, which could spell disaster again for United this weekend if it's anywhere near a 7-0 victory like last time out.
Manchester United have even failed to score in their last four Premier League away games against Liverpool and it doesn't bode well for them after also going goalless in their last two clashes in all competitions, against Bournemouth and Bayern.
Liverpool have also won all seven of their games at home this season, as they look to defend their lead at the top of the table and also their long running unbeaten streak.
The stats don't help United fans feel better when looking at goal scored this season. Liverpool are averaging three goals per game at home and well over two per game as a whole. And while they are conceding close to a goal per game it doesn't seem to be causing an issue in their ability to get wins.
United on the other hand, haven't drawn at all this season and have lost as many as seven already while scoring the least amount of goals in the top 14 teams while conceding 21 in 16 matches.
